Top 10 Home Audio Companies in Denmark 2025:
1. Bang & Olufsen
– Market Share: 30%
– Bang & Olufsen continues to dominate the home audio market in Denmark with its premium audio products known for their exceptional sound quality and sleek design.
2. Dynaudio
– Market Share: 15%
– Dynaudio is a key player in the Danish home audio industry, offering a wide range of high-end speakers and sound systems that cater to audiophiles.
3. Dali
– Market Share: 12%
– Dali is known for its innovative speaker technology and has gained a strong foothold in the Danish market with its high-performance audio products.
4. Audiovector
– Market Share: 8%
– Audiovector is a reputable Danish audio company that focuses on delivering immersive sound experiences through its range of speakers and sound systems.
5. Ortofon
– Market Share: 6%
– Ortofon specializes in high-quality cartridges and stylus for turntables, catering to music enthusiasts who value precision and clarity in audio reproduction.
6. Scandyna
– Market Share: 5%
– Scandyna is recognized for its unique and stylish speakers that combine aesthetics with superior sound quality, appealing to design-conscious consumers.
7. System Audio
– Market Share: 4%
– System Audio offers a diverse range of speakers and sound systems that are designed to deliver a balanced and natural sound reproduction for an immersive listening experience.
8. Vifa
– Market Share: 3%
– Vifa is known for its portable Bluetooth speakers that combine Scandinavian design with high-quality audio performance, catering to modern consumers on the go.
9. AIAIAI
– Market Share: 2%
– AIAIAI specializes in headphones and earphones designed for professional audio monitoring, attracting DJs, producers, and music enthusiasts with its precision sound.
10. Libratone
– Market Share: 2%
– Libratone offers a range of wireless speakers and headphones that prioritize versatility and convenience without compromising on audio quality, appealing to tech-savvy consumers.
